Bongo666 wrote:The KFC business delivered another quarter of positive sales growth. The company’s biggest brand, contributing over two thirds of total sales, produced a sales increase of $3.0 million for the quarter to a total of $50.0 million. The $50.0 million total marks another sales record for KFC as the highest first quarter total since the inception of Restaurant Brands.
Apart from the highly misleading sales figures quoted for KFC (inflation makes this quarter far from a record) and a failure of Starbucks to once again fire it looks like RBD are starting to get things right.
KFC IS doing much better and I can attest to that from my occasional visits to buy the lovely greasy stuff - the service is vastly better and the food seems a little more consistent in quality.
Good to see Pizza Hut finally coming back from the abyss, although 1 slice of sales doesn't yet make the full Pizza. Give them a few more quarters to sort themselves out.
